adjective
- unable to see the difference between certain colors, especially red and green
- not influenced by considerations of race or ethnicity; treating all people equally regardless of skin color
Usage: medical condition
Usage: social context
Examples
- He is colorblind and cannot distinguish between red and green traffic lights.
- The colorblind artist uses special software to help choose paint colors.
- About 8% of men are colorblind to some degree.
- The company strives to maintain colorblind hiring practices.
- She believes in a colorblind approach to education.
- The judge was praised for his colorblind interpretation of the law.
- Critics argue that truly colorblind policies ignore historical inequalities.
